How does a Remote Software Project Manager effectively coordinate team members across different time zones?

As a Remote Software Project Manager, coordinating team members in multiple time zones involves thoughtful scheduling, clear communication channels, and effective use of collaboration tools. Successful managers typically establish core hours for overlapping work, set clear expectations for response times, and use project management platforms to track progress and share updates. Regular virtual meetings and asynchronous communication, such as detailed documentation and recorded updates, help ensure everyone stays aligned and informed despite geographical differences.

What is a Remote Software Project Manager?

A Remote Software Project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ing software development projects while working from a location outside of a traditional office setting. They coordinate teams, manage timelines, allocate resources, and ensure that project goals are met, all through virtual communication tools. Their role involves planning, executing, and finalizing projects according to deadlines and within budget. They must also facilitate collaboration among geographically dispersed team members and stakeholders, using tools like video conferencing, project management software, and online collaboration platforms.

What Does a Remote Software Project Manager Do?

As a remote software project manager, you work from home, assisting members of a software development and testing team in the creation, testing, and optimization of computer software for a business or organization. Your duties are to plan a budget for a project, outline the project scope, delegate tasks to team members, oversee project operations and team performance, and ensure the successful completion of the project. Remote software project managers can be either employees of a technology or software development company who carry out their job responsibilities from home or independent contractors who design and oversee projects for private clients.

Job Title: Technical Project Manager
Salary: 65k/year
Position Overview
We are se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ented Technical Project Manager to support the successful delivery of technology projects by coordinating communication, documentation, workflows, and project execution activities. This role serves as a key partner to the VP of Technology, helping translate client and business requirements into actionable development tasks while ensuring projects remain organized, documented, and on track.
The ideal candidate possesses a foundational understanding of technology concepts and software development processes but excels in project coordination, requirements gathering, documentation, process design, and stakeholder communication. This individual will work directly alongside the VP of Technology on client-facing initiatives, supporting meetings, documenting requirements, managing project timelines, tracking deliverables, and serving as a liaison between business stakeholders and the development team.
Project Management & Coordination
  • Support the planning, execution, and delivery of multiple technology projects simultaneously
  • Develop and maintain project plans, timelines, task lists, and project documentation.
  • Track project milestones, deliverables, risks, and dependencies.
  • Coordinate internal project meetings and maintain action item tracking.
  • Ensure project stakeholders have visibility into project status and upcoming deliverables.

Client & Stakeholder Support
  • Partner closely with the VP of Technology on client-facing projects and initiatives.
  • Participate in client meetings to document requirements, decisions, action items, and follow-up tasks.
  • Assist in gathering business requirements and clarifying project objectives.
  • Serve as a communication bridge between clients, business stakeholders, and internal development teams.
  • Help manage stakeholder expectations through proactive communication and documentation.

Requirements Gathering & Documentation
  • Create and maintain comprehensive project documentation, including BRDs, functional specifications, user stories, process maps, workflow diagrams, SOPs, meeting notes, and action item registers.
  • Translate business discussions into clear and actionable requirements for technical teams.
  • Maintain organized project repositories and ensure documentation remains current.

Development Team Coordination
  • Work closely with developers, designers, QA resources, and business stakeholders to facilitate project execution.
  • Assist with backlog management, sprint planning, and task prioritization activities.
  • Ensure development teams have the information and documentation needed to complete assigned work.
  • Coordinate testing activities, user acceptance testing (UAT), and deployment readiness efforts.
  • Help identify and resolve project blockers through collaboration with project stakeholders.

Process Improvement
  • Assist in developing repeatable project management standards and best practices.
  • Identify opportunities to improve workflows, communication processes, and project delivery methods.
  • Support the implementation and administration of project management and documentation tools.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ives across technology and business operations.

Required Qualifications
  • 3+ years of project coordination, project management, business analyst, implementation, or similar experience.
  • Exceptional organizational and documentation skills.
  • Strong written and verbal communication abilities.
  • Experience creating detailed project documentation and workflow diagrams.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ects and priorities simultaneously.
  • Strong problem-solving and analytical skills.
  • Familiarity with software development lifecycles (SDLC).

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ience working with software development teams.
  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Information Systems, Project Management, or a related field.
  • Understanding of APIs, integrations, databases, and web-based applications.
  • Familiarity with Agile, Scrum, or hybrid project management methodologies.
  • Experience using ClickUp, Jira, Smartsheet, Monday.com, or similar project management platforms.
  • Experience with Lucidchart, Visio, Miro, or similar workflow and process mapping tools.
  • PMP, CAPM, Scrum Master, or Business Analyst certifications are a plus.

Technical Knowledge Expectations
This role is not expected to perform software development work but should possess sufficient technical understanding to understand software development concepts, participate in discussions regarding integrations and application workflows, translate business requirements into technical documentation, identify project dependencies and risks, and communicate effectively with both technical and non-technical stakeholders.
